Boonville, IN and Crawfordsville, IN have a very similar cost of living, with only a 1.1% difference in their overall index. Boonville scores 69 while Crawfordsville scores 69 on the cost of living index, where 100 represents the national average. The day-to-day expenses for residents in both cities are comparable, though differences emerge when looking at specific categories.

On the housing front, median rent in Boonville is $835/month compared to $831/month in Crawfordsville — a 1%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Crawfordsville is more affordable at $134,100 median vs $143,100.

Median household income in Boonville is $62,500 compared to $49,327 in Crawfordsville (+26.7%). Boonville off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Boonville spend roughly 16% of their income on rent, less than the 20.2% in Crawfordsville.
